Academic honors are awarded at the end of each quarter to students attaining an average of 3.5 or better. Those students who achieve a grade point average of 3.8 or greater are awarded High Honors.

Sacred Heart Academy, an independent college preparatory school founded in 1946 by the Apostles of the Sacred Heart of Jesus successfully prepares young women in grades 9 through12 for learning, service and achievement in a global society. The Academy currently has 500 plus students are enrolled and hail from five counties in Connecticut - New Haven, Fairfield, Middlesex, Hartford and New London.
